Wild Bear Sneaks Into Village Temple in odissa

Bhawanipatna December 24 : A wild bear sneaked into the human habitation creating panic among the locals at Amapani near Dharmagarh here in Kalahandi district on Wednesday night.

A video of the animal roaming around the Budharaja temple at Amapani is doing round on the social media.

Locals who have sighted the animal said that it came to the temple on Wednesday night and moved around for one hour before the leaving the place.

Later, it also strayed into the village area and went back to the nearest forest, a local said.

People said, the bear entered the human settlement in search of food.

However, the animal has not attacked anyone nor the residents have teased it, they added.

In the video, the bear was seen walking in front of the temple gate. There were no priests present on the premises of the shrine, locals added.

Though the forest department officials are aware about the incident, they have not yet made any comments on the matter.

In August this year, a wild bear had strayed into the human settlement in Bhawanipatna city and attacked a person. The incident had triggered panic among local residents.

A video of the animal attacking a man had also gone viral on social media. In the video, local people were seen trying to rescue the man by hitting the animal with sticks. Forest officials had tried hard to capture the bear by tranquilising it and release it into the forest.

In 2012, a bear ‘couple’, who had frequented to Goddess Bhairav temple on the outskirts of Malkangiri town, had hogged the headlines. The animals had attracted the visitors as they used to come to the temple everyday just after sunset and stayed for quite some time. The passersby and visitors had also fed them with bananas, biscuits and coconuts. However, the wild animals had not attacked anyone rather they had turned a source of entertainment for the locals and passersby.
